一、问题概述
当用户报告“TPWallet 连不上”时,应把问题拆成客户端、网络、节点/服务端、以及第三方依赖四类排查对象。并行检查用户侧环境与服务端状态,可以快速定位是否为普遍性故障或个别用户问题。
二、排查步骤(优先级与细化)
1. 网络与DNS:确认用户网络连通(ping、traceroute)、DNS解析是否正确,是否存在被运营商或企业防火墙拦截的IP/端口。备用DNS和域名解析缓存清理是常见快速修复手段。
2. 证书与TLS/HTTPS:检查客户端时间是否正确、证书是否过期或被中间人拦截(使用openssl s_client或浏览器开发者工具)。
3. 节点健康与负载:查看后端节点/负载均衡状态、CPU/内存、连接数、线程池等,是否存在宕机或过载导致拒绝连接。
4. 版本与兼容性:客户端与服务器协议是否匹配(RPC版本、API变更、加密库更新)。
5. 配置与权限:检查API key、whitelist、CORS、IP白名单、端口映射、防火墙策略。
6. 日志与速率限制:从客户端与服务器日志查看错误码(认证失败、超时、429限流等),确认是否被限流或封禁。
三、私密交易功能的技术与合规考量

1. 技术实现:可选方案包括混合器/CoinJoin、同态加密、zk-SNARKs/zk-STARKs、环签名或闪电/状态通道隐藏交易路径。不同方案在性能、实现复杂度与匿名性强度上有权衡。
2. 可用性影响:隐私方案往往增加计算开销和延迟,需衡量对高并发场景的影响,并考虑采用可选隐私级别或批处理模式以降低实时成本。
3. 合规风险:强化KYC/AML流程、可审计的合规保留(如可控匿名或合规回溯机制),并与法律团队和监管方沟通,避免服务被下架或冻结。
四、高效能技术平台建议
1. 架构:采用分层架构(接入层、业务层、数据层),通过负载均衡、微服务、服务网格和熔断机制保证可用性。
2. 扩展性:使用水平扩展的数据库/缓存(Redis、Cassandra)、异步队列(Kafka)、读写分离及分片技术。
3. 延迟优化:热点缓存、批处理合并请求、零拷贝和高效序列化(如Protobuf)。针对签名和加密操作,使用本地加速或硬件加速(HSM)。
4. 监控与自动化:完整的可观测性(Prometheus/Grafana/Tracing)、自动伸缩、CI/CD与灰度发布。
五、市场调研与全球支付管理要点
1. 用户画像:区分散户、商户、机构客户的需求(隐私、结算速度、手续费敏感度)。
2. 竞争与差异化:对标主要钱包与支付平台,找出差异化功能(多币种管理、即刻结算、合规隐私选项)。
3. 全球合规:跨境支付涉及多国法规、外汇管控、制裁名单及税务合规,需建立区域合规策略与合规自动化工具。
4. 结算与清算:支持多种结算路径(链上结算、法币通道、清算合作伙伴),并优化资金池管理以降低滑点与费用。
六、共识算法对钱包与支付系统的影响
1. 吞吐与延迟:PoW通常延迟高、吞吐低;PoS、DPoS或BFT类在支付场景中更常用以换取高TPS与快速最终性。选择取决于安全模型与去中心化需求。
2. 最终性与一致性:快速最终性有利于即时结算与减少双花风险;对接多链时需处理不同链的最终性模型与跨链中继策略。
3. 混合方案:对于需要高吞吐且保留一定去中心化的场景,可采用主链+侧链/状态通道的混合架构。

七、支付限额设计与风险控制
1. 限额类型:单笔上限、日累计、速率限额、风险分级限额(基于KYC级别与行为评分)。
2. 动态策略:基于风控评分动态调整限额并结合多因子验证(行为、地理、设备指纹、交易历史)。
3. 争议与客户体验:提供分级提升流程(人工审核、加强认证)以平衡安全与用户体验。
八、建议与优先推进项
1. 立即:按上述排查顺序定位“连不上”根因,开放透明的状态页与临时补救(备用节点、回滚配置)。
2. 短期(1-3月):强化监控、自动化限流/熔断、快速回滚机制;在测试环境验证隐私功能的性能开销。
3. 中长期:制定隐私合规框架、实施高性能扩展(Layer2/状态通道)、选择适配支付场景的共识方案并部署分区域合规策略。
结论:TPWallet 连不上往往是多因素叠加的结果,既要做即时的技术排查和恢复,也需从架构、隐私、合规、市场及风控层面统筹规划,以确保长期的可用性、性能与合规性。
评论
TechLiu
排查步骤写得很细,证书和限流这两点我之前没注意到,收获很大。
小明
关于私密交易的合规建议很实际,建议再补充一个常见法规清单。
CryptoFan88
喜欢最后的优先推进项,分短期与中长期很有操作性。
支付研究员
共识算法对最终性的分析很到位,建议在跨链部分再举几个实战案例。
AnnaW
高性能平台的硬件加速和HSM建议很好,能提高安全性和签名效率。